Pros
Pro HID gamepad support
The Bard's Tale support native Android HID.
Pro Funny and excellent storytelling
Rarely anything on mobile platform is on par with the storytelling in this game.
Pro SHIELD games support
SHIELD games support is built into this game.
Pro MOGA support
The Bard's Tale has MOGA support built in.
Pro Optional high res textures for Tegra 3 devices
The Bard's Tale allows for a high res texture pack to be downloaded and used if the user is using a Tegra 3 device.
Pro Online and LAN co-op
Users can connect over LAN or TCP/IP for up to 6 player co-op.
Pro New NPCs to choose from
There are two or three new NPCs your PC encounters, and can add one or more to your adventuring party.
Pro Plays like original with more portraits available for PCs and the Black Pits arena combat module
Plays just like the original game with the same hidden treasures. When creating PCs, you have more available portraits to choose from. Black Pits Arena combat module is awesome, but gets really deadly in the later rounds.
Cons
Con On screen thumb control has permanent placement
The thumb stick placement on screen does not follow around the users thumb b y where they touch the screen but is static in one place.
Con Modded original can offer better experience
Depending on if one want to go through the trouble, but modding the original game can offer a better experience over this enhanced edition.
